Web10 Jun 2024 · Estrogen alerts the mammary tissue of the pregnancy, starting the production of the cells that will secrete milk. Progesterone depends on estrogen and helps maintain milk secretion during lactation. WebMaiden mares may also secrete milk during the last 30 days of gestation, but many maiden mares will not be stimulated to produce milk until the hours preceding the birth of the foal. Both are considered normal. Mastitis, "inflammation of the mammary gland," is most often encountered when foals are weaned. It is important to keep a watchful eye ...
